2013-01-18 44 views
1

我只是改變了我的asp.net項目的屬性,如下所示。Asp.net項目屬性「Web Use Local IIs Web Server」影響其他團隊成員

Property\Web\Use Local IIS Web Server \ Project Url: http://domain.com 
Property\Web\Use Local IIS Web Server \ Override application root URL: http://domain.com 

但是在svn中提交之後。這些變化反映在其他團隊成員的項目中。因爲這些設置在應用程序的項目文件中。

我也不能忽略這個項目文件提交。因爲在這種情況下,其他成員不會從svn正確更新我的工作。

如何保持這些設置只對我個人,同時不斷提交Web應用程序的項目文件。

回答

0

如果您將這些更改保留在項目文件中,您將不可避免地導致SVN中的版本控制問題,這不是最好的方法。一種方法是將項目設置保持原樣(我假設您正在使用IIS,其他人都使用Cassini或IIS Express),但在本地IIS中創建一個網站。然後,不是通過F5或CTRL-F5運行應用程序,而是通過Debug > Attach to process手動將調試器附加到ASP.NET工作進程。

相關問題